Accounting Manager |
 |
Department: Accounting & Finance |
|
Position Type: Full-time |
 |
Description: |
The Accounting Manager offers a variety of services to the Accounting & Finance Group. While providing oversight to the payroll and billing departments, this key position is also involved in month-end closing procedures, process revision and development, job costing activities, internal control development, and other special projects. Candidates should have management experience and exhibit initiative, problem awareness, decisiveness, conscientiousness, and a strong customer service attitude. While certain components of the position are fixed, candidates should be flexible and willing to take on new assignments and special projects as needed. Responsibilities are primarily accounting-natured, but often require cross-functional collaboration and teamwork. Candidates should demonstrate enthusiasm for the development of direct reports and bring an avenue of experience in accounting, reporting, and problem solving.

Responsibilities include: |
- Manage and provide guidance for Payroll and AP.
- Monitor and improve consistency in practices.
- Drive month-end close procedures (balancing applications with GL, supporting the Assistant Controller with analysis and clean-up, etc.).
- General support for Corporate Controller and Assistant Controller.
- Assist with operating plan development.
- Provide support to branch and project managers with special analysis, ad hoc reports, etc.
- Heavy involvement in roll-out of new ERP system (beginning Q4 2004).
|
 |
Requirements: |
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Business Administration required. CPA a plus
- 5-7 years of general accounting experience (public accounting experience is a plus)
- Experience in a construction environment (preferable a specialty contractor i.e., electrical, mechanical, plumbing, etc.) is a must
- Specialized knowledge: Understanding of core GAAP and familiarity with SOP 81-1 (Accounting for Performance of Construction-Type Contracts)
- Supervisory responsibility: This position currently manages the payroll and billing supervisors but may also assume responsibility for additional functions (accounts payable, job cost, etc.)
